The American Legion Auxiliary (ALA) 990-N is an annual electronic notice (e-Postcard) submitted to the IRS by small tax-exempt organizations, including certain branches of the American Legion Auxiliary, with gross receipts of $50,000 or less.
Small tax-exempt organizations, such as certain branches of the American Legion Auxiliary, with gross receipts of $50,000 or less are required to file the 990-N.
The American Legion Auxiliary 990-N can be filled out online through the IRS website by providing basic information about the organization's gross receipts, activities, and contact information.
The purpose of the American Legion Auxiliary 990-N is to provide the IRS with basic information about small tax-exempt organizations, such as certain branches of the American Legion Auxiliary, to ensure compliance with federal tax laws.
The American Legion Auxiliary 990-N requires basic information about the organization's gross receipts, activities, and contact information to be reported.
